Russian citizen. Arrested on May 28, 2021 for a tweet written on May 23. The tweet led to a publication in LiveJournal with a reprint of the BBC Russian Service material about the incident with the Ryanair plane (on which Roman Protasevich was flying). Vikholm added her own title to the reprint: "Lukashenko's next crime: an act of state air piracy" , and the phrase "act of state air piracy" was cited in the text of the BBC as a reaction of the Greek Foreign Ministry.
On September 1, 2022, she was released after the expiration of her sentence and immediately deported to the Russian Federation without the right to enter the Republic of Belarus for 10 years.

According to the charges , on April 2, 2021, intending to publicly insult the deputy prosecutor, he sent an email to the Vitebsk Regional Prosecutor's Office. It began with the word "Korenko" and ended with "Bessmertny" and had a negative form of evaluation of the official, represented the "abusive segment". On the same day, intending to publicly insult the first deputy chairman of the district executive committee, he sent a letter to the district executive committee in which he insulted the official. It was aimed at forming a negative image of the government official. The letter began with the word "Lyutinsky" and ended with the words "everything is possible", as well as another letter.
He also violated the terms of his permit to carry a weapon and illegally stored explosives: smoke powder, which is suitable for causing an explosion.
On September 1, 2021, he was sentenced to three years of imprisonment in a strict regime penal colony : 2.5 years of restriction of the penal colony without referral to a correctional facility - "house chemistry" - under Article 369 and three years of imprisonment in a strict regime penal colony - under Part 2 of Article 295.
He is expected to be released at the end of August 2024.

According to the indictment, Igor Grishchenkov publicly insulted Lukashenka from October 26, 2020 to November 13, 2021 in the Let's Help Baranovichi chat. Three times he posted there a photograph of Lukashenka "in a humiliating form - clown makeup." Under one of the posts, he posted a comment that contained the word "rat", under the second - "schizophrenic". The examination recognized that the comments "contain a negative assessment of the male personality, placed on the photo”.
According to human rights activists, he will be released in the fall of 2023 upon expiration of his sentence.

Alexander was first arrested in March 2021 and convicted of "participating in group actions that grossly violate public order" in a criminal case opened after a protest on September 13, 2020, in Brest. At that time, the participants were singing and dancing in a circle, and a water cannon was used against them. He served his full sentence and was released in July 2022.
However, in December 2023, it became known about his new arrest in connection with a criminal case opened after spontaneous protests that took place on August 10, 2020 in Brest against falsifications in the presidential elections. In April 2024, he was sentenced to imprisonment for participating in the protest.
He was released in September 2024 as part of a pardon.
